How did the daughter of liberty contribute to the american boycott of British goods in the late 1760

They helped contribute to the american boycott of British goods because they participated in spinning bees, helping to produce homespun cloth for colonists to wear instead of British textiles. The women were also used to enforce this movement because they were the ones responsible for purchasing goods for their households.
